Istanbul Marathon 2024
Running from Asia to Europe across the Bosphorus Strait!Istanbul features the only intercontinental marathon there is and the city, its people & the race hold a special place in my heart. Needless to say the food is fantastic!
We had to battle head winds with gusts of up to 55 km/h but finishing this race was an exhilarating experience.
